Executive Director
Michael joined PILI in 2006 as Pro Bono Initiative Director and more recently served as PILI's Director of Programs prior to being named Executive Director on December 1, 2010. Prior to joining PILI in 2006, Michael served as the Guardian Ad Litem Program Director for Chicago Volunteer Legal Services. An active member of the American Bar Association, Michael is serving as Chair of the ABA Young Lawyers Division and Vice Chair of the Lawyers Conference of the Judicial Division during the 2011-12 bar year. He previously served for three years on the Presidential Advisory Council on Diversity in the Profession. Michael is also a member of the Illinois State Bar Association where he serves on the Assembly and Young Lawyers Division Council and is a past chair of the Standing Committee on the Delivery of Legal Services and Child Law Committee. Michael is an Adjunct Professor at the DePaul University College of Law, where he also serves on the Advisory Board for the Center for Public Interest Law. He also serves on the Advisory Board of the Chicago Lawyer Chapter of the American Constitution Society. He has also served on the boards of directors of several community organizations. Frequently recognized for his contributions to the bar, Michael was also named the 2005 recipient of the Kimball and Karen Anderson Public Interest Law Fellowship from The Chicago Bar Foundation and the 2007 Outstanding Young Alumnus from DePaul University College of Law.
Michael attended The Catholic University of America in Washington, D.C., where he earned his Bachelor of Arts in Politics. He received his Juris Doctor from DePaul University College of Law. Prior to and during law school, Michael was a consultant with the Financial Planning Solutions Group of PricewaterhouseCoopers LLP, responsible for project management and business development.

Shana Heller-Ogden
Development & Communications Associate
Shana joined PILI in February 2011 as its Development & Communications Associate. She previously served as a Domestic Violence Education and Outreach VISTA at the Sargent Shriver National Center on Poverty Law and as the Teen Services Trainer with Women Empowered Against Violence (WEAVE) in Washington, DC. Shana holds a Master of Nonprofit Management from DePaul University's School of Public Service, and she graduated summa cum laude and Phi Beta Kappa from Valparaiso University with a Bachelor of Arts in Secondary Education, French and Theology.

Julia M. Kepler
Office Administrator
Julia joined PILI as its Office Administrator in March 2011. She most recently served as Office Manager and Assistant to the Executive Director for Congregation Bnei Ruven. In this position, Julia had responsibility for all aspects of office and financial administration for one of the largest synagogues in Chicago. Julia currently serves as Secretary to the Board of Directors with the Cuentos Foundation, which creates and facilitates cross-cultural interdisciplinary art programs giving voice to the stories (cuentos) of our diverse communities. Previously, Julia interned with the Clifton Cultural Arts Center in Cincinnati, Ohio and the Dayton Art Institute in Dayton, Ohio. Julia attended Ohio University and obtained her Bachelor of Fine Arts in Art History with a certificate in Women’s Studies. She is currently pursuing a Master of Public Administration with a focus in Nonprofit Management from Roosevelt University.

Sheila Simhan
Program Manager
Sheila joined PILI in February 2011 as its Program Manager following two years as an Adjunct Professor and Clinical Fellow at the Small Business Opportunity Center (SBOC) at Northwestern University School of Law. Prior to her time at the SBOC, Sheila was a summer associate in the Chicago office of Katten Muchin Rosenman LLP and the Madison office of Foley & Lardner LLP. Sheila currently serves on the Board of Directors of campusCATALYST, a nonprofit organization that partners with universities to engage college and business school students in high-impact pro bono consulting for nonprofit organizations. Sheila earned her Juris Doctor, cum laude, from the University of Wisconsin Law School. She graduated cum laude from the University of Wisconsin - Madison with a Bachelor of Arts in Psychology and Legal Studies.
